Department Overview:
The PA will help create and maintain online resources that support badge participants, including a website and Canvas course site. The assistant will also support the integration between Canvas and the Parchment Digital Badging platform, assist with student communications and outreach, and respond to student inquiries regarding the digital badges.

Qualifications:
Required Qualifications • Current graduate student enrolled at the University of Wisconsin–Madison. • Experience creating or maintaining websites. • Familiarity with or willingness to learn Canvas. • Strong written and verbal communication skills. • Excellent organizational and time-management skills. • Ability to work independently, take initiative, and manage multiple priorities. • Ability to collaborate effectively as part of a team. Preferred Qualifications • Interest in instructional design, educational technology, digital learning, or higher education administration. • Experience with learning management systems, website design, or digital content creation. • Experience providing customer service or student support.

Position Summary/Job Duties:
Digital Badge Program Development and Support • Assist with the administration and implementation of digital badge programs focused on Intercultural Competence, Critical Thinking on Global Issues, and WISLI. • Support the integration of Canvas resources with the Parchment Digital Badging platform. • Help facilitate badge-awarding processes and ensure a positive user experience for participants. Website and Canvas Resource Development • Design, develop, and maintain a website that serves as a central resource hub for badge participants. • Create and organize content within Canvas to support student learning and engagement. • Ensure badge resources are accessible, user-friendly, and up to date. • Collaborate with the Associate Director to develop new digital learning materials and resources. Student Communications and Outreach • Respond to student inquiries regarding badge requirements, processes, and participation. • Assist in developing communication materials, announcements, promotional content, and outreach strategies. • Support efforts to increase awareness and participation in badge programs. Project Coordination and Administrative Support • Track project timelines, tasks, and program documentation. • Assist with data collection, recordkeeping, and program evaluation activities. • Participate in meetings and collaborate with campus partners as needed. • Contribute to continuous improvement efforts for badge programs and associated resources.
